CVE-2017-10928 (GCVE-0-2017-10928)

Vulnerability from cvelistv5 – Published: 2017-07-05 11:00 – Updated: 2024-08-05 17:50
VLAI
Summary
In ImageMagick 7.0.6-0, a heap-based buffer over-read in the GetNextToken function in token.c allows remote attackers to obtain sensitive information from process memory or possibly have unspecified other impact via a crafted SVG document that is mishandled in the GetUserSpaceCoordinateValue function in coders/svg.c.
